Simons-Morton, Bruce G.; And Others – Research Quarterly for Exercise and Sport, 1994
Researchers assessed the ability of third and fifth graders to recall and report types and amounts of physical activity from the previous day. The study assessed the validity of the Caltrac electronic accelerometer as a field measure of physical activity. Children's reported physical activity minutes were higher than monitored minutes. (SM)

McKenzie, Thomas L.; And Others – Research Quarterly for Exercise and Sport, 1993
Evaluates the effects of a combined health-related curriculum and inservice program on quality and quantity of elementary school physical education lessons. Findings from observations of 28 fourth-grade classes showed positive results in student activity engagement, lesson context, and active instructional behavior. (GLR)
